Preparation time: 15 mins
Cooking time: 12 mins
Serves: 4
Ingredients:
2 tomatoes, halved, seeded and chopped
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t, plus extra, in needed
pinch of sugar
3/4 cup cooked cannellini beans
juice of 1/2 lime
1 tablespoon finely chopped fresh cilantro
4 tablespoon of olive oil
3 tablespoons unsalted butter
1 baguette, thinly sliced
1 garlic clove, halved
How to make California Style Bruschetta:
1 Place the tomatoes in a medium serving bowl and stir in the salt and sugar. Mix in the beans, lime juice, cilantro, and 1 tablespoon of the olive oil. Taste and add more salt if needed, then set aside.
2. Melt 1 1/2 tablespoons of the butter with 1 1/2 tablespoons of the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Place half of the bread slices in the pan and cook until golden brown on both sides, 4 to 6 minutes total. Remove the toasted bread from the pan and set aside. Add the remaining 1 1/2 tablespoons butter and 1 1/2 tablespoons oil to the pan and repeat with the remaining bread slices. While the bread is still warm, rub one side of each slice with the garlic. Spoon some of the bean-tomato mixtures on top of each fried bread slice and serve.
